Communication coordination in network controllability
Better understanding our ability to control an interconnected system of entities has been one of the central challenges in network science. The theories of node and edge controllability have been the main methodologies suggested to find the minimal set of nodes enabling control over the whole system's dynamics.

Coordination Control of Complex Machines [PDF]
Control and coordination are important aspects of the development of complex machines due to an ever-increasing demand for better functionality, quality, and performance. In WP6 of the C4C project, we developed a synthesis-centric systems engineering framework suitable for supervisory coordination of complex systems.
